Strategy guides get released earlier and earlier these days so a lot of them lack information changed or added during the final stages of game development. A lot of them also lack information just because the strategy guide publishers want to release them before or at the same time the game is released. The strategy guide for Ninja Gaiden didn't even have all 50 scarabs listed. For competitive games, the guides are useless for multiplayer and the strategies they have are already obsolete in a week or two.

Strategy guides should not exist in the form they seem to currently.
Thus I've never bought one.
A strategy guide should be just that. A guide to strategy.
But all too often they are effectively the manual & the game itself comes with merely a quickstart guide.
With all that CA has been making of the ingame help, a strategy guide for Rome should be more or less reduced to a real strategy guide & thus not useful to a Shogun/Medieval veteran.
